Men's Lacrosse Falls to No. 8 SUNY Cortland 10-6

CORTLAND, N.Y. – Senior Bryan Smith scored a pair of goals, but eighth-ranked SUNY Cortland posted a 10-6 victory over Albright on Wednesday in non-conference action at Stadium Red.

The Red Dragons raced out to a 4-0 lead in the first quarter, which proved to be the difference in the game.

Albright, which dropped to 1-1 on the season, also received goals from Andrew Potter, Derek Stump, Matthew Lomady and James Egleston. For Stump, Lomady and Egleston it marked their first goals of the 2015 season.

T.J. Holston and Philip Potter each had two assists for Albright.

Zach Hopps and James Stavrakis each had three goals to lead Cortland, which improved to 1-1 on the season. Luke McNaney added two goals, while Matt Rakoczy had a goal and two assists.

Cortland wasted little time getting on the scoreboard as Hopps gave the Red Dragons a 1-0 lead with 13:33 to play in the first quarter.

Mike Cantelli scored an unassisted goal to make it 2-0 and Stavrakis scored back-to-back goals to extend the lead to 4-0 with 6:03 to play in the opening quarter.

Smith got Albright on the board with 2:49 to play in the first when he scored an unassisted goal.

Hopps second goal of the game, at the 13:43 mark of the second quarter, pushed the Cortland lead to 5-1 but Smith answered with his second goal off a feed from Holston to trim the margin to 5-2.

McNaney gave Cortland a 6-2 lead at the intermission when he scored 26 seconds before halftime.

Stavrakis made it 7-2 Cortland on his third goal of the game with 8:21 to play in the third quarter.

Lomady cut the lead to 7-3 when he tallied an unassisted goal with 1:51 left in the third, but Cortland responded with two goals in eight seconds to open the fourth quarter to take a 9-3 lead.

Egleston notched his first goal of the season off a pass from Philip Potter to cut the lead to 9-4, but McNaney answered for Cortland to increase the lead to 10-4 with 6:25 to play.

Stump scored an even-strength goal on a feed from Holston and Andrew Potter capped the scoring with a goal with 20 seconds remaining in the game.

Albright will return to action on Saturday (March 7) when it hosts SUNY Potsdam at 4 p.m. at Marywood University in Scranton, Pa.
